“…A publication by Soga33 reports the synthesis of a highly alternating copolymer (ED + DE diads = 98.2%) of ethylene and 1,9‐decadiene using catalyst 2 and MAO. The copolymers obtained showed no evidence of crosslinking or cyclization.…”

“…The properties of ethylene copolymers depend on the number and identities of comonomer units in the chain; incorporation of 1-butene, 1-hexene, and 1-octene comonomers is commonly used to control the density and crystallinity of polyethylene. ,, One of the advantages of metallocene and other single-site catalysts is their ability to generate random copolymers with uniform compositions. These new well-defined catalysts also present additional opportunities to develop catalyst systems for generating polymers of defined sequence distributions such as alternating ,− ,, or blocky 1,4,5 copolymers.…”

“…Recently, several classes of metallocene catalysts have emerged which are able to generate alternating copolymers of ethylene and α-olefins such as propylene, hexene, and octene. − , Two strategies have emerged for the synthesis of such copolymers: the first involves catalysts based on C s -symmetric fluorenyl-ligated metallocenes. Alternating ethylene−propylene copolymers can be obtained from ansa -bisfluorenylmetallocenes ,,, or Me 2 C(3,4-Me 2 Cp)(fluorenyl)ZrCl 2 .…”

“…Me 2 Si-(Flu) 2 ZrCl 2 /MAO brings about alternating copolymerization of ethylene with 1,9-decadiene without cyclization or crosslinking to give polymer having pendant octenyl group, which can be used for polymer reaction such as hydrosilylation. 228 The copolymerization of diallylsilanes with ethylene catalyzed by zirconocenes allows the corresponding copolymers to have silacyclohexane units (Figure 44). 230 Bridged zirconocenes showed higher activity than nonbridged zirconocenes.…”
